Fulkhali - Karimpur - I, Nadia
Fulkhali is a village situated in the Karimpur - I subdivision of Nadia district, West Bengal. It is located approximately 1.8 km from the tehsil headquarters in Karimpur and around 85.4 km from the district headquarters in Krishnanagar. Shikarpur serves as the Gram Panchayat for Fulkhali village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Fulkhali is 321108. The village covers a total geographical area of 157.07 hectares and falls under the 741158 pincode. Berhampur is the nearest town, located about 10 km away.
Fulkhali village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.
Population of Fulkhali
As per Census 2011, Fulkhali village has a total population of 1,783 people, consisting of 914 males and 869 females. The village has 480 households and a sex ratio of 950 females per 1,000 males. There are 180 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 980 literate and 803 illiterate residents. Additionally, 729 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 7 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Fulkhali
Fulkhali is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within 5-10 km of the village. The nearest railway station is Berhampore Court, while the nearest airport is Malda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 105.2 km.
